数据库四个特征是什么意思

飞飞 其他 1

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库四个特征指的是数据库管理系统(DBMS)具备的四个基本特点,即数据独立性、数据共享性、数据一致性和数据持久性。

    1. 数据独立性:数据库系统能够实现数据与应用程序的独立性。具体来说,数据独立性指的是应用程序与数据的逻辑结构和物理结构相互独立。应用程序可以通过逻辑结构来操作数据,而不需要了解数据的物理存储方式。这样可以提高应用程序的开发效率,并且在数据库结构变化时,不需要修改应用程序代码。

    2. 数据共享性:数据库系统能够实现数据的共享和集中管理。多个用户可以同时访问数据库中的数据,不同的用户可以根据其权限进行不同的操作。这样可以提高数据的利用率和共享性,避免数据的冗余和数据的不一致性。

    3. 数据一致性:数据库系统能够保持数据的一致性。在数据库中,数据的一致性指的是数据满足预定的完整性约束条件,不会出现冲突和矛盾。数据库系统通过事务机制和并发控制来确保数据的一致性,避免了数据的丢失和损坏。

    4. 数据持久性:数据库系统能够保持数据的持久性。持久性指的是数据在数据库中的长期存储和保留。即使在系统崩溃或断电的情况下,数据库系统也能够通过日志和恢复机制来恢复数据,并确保数据的完整性和一致性。

    这四个特征是数据库系统设计和管理的基础,能够提供高效、可靠、安全的数据存储和管理服务,广泛应用于各个领域。

    3个月前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    数据库的四个特征指的是数据的共享性、冗余度小、数据的独立性和数据的持久性。

    1. 数据的共享性:数据库中的数据可以被多个用户共同使用,不同的用户可以通过访问数据库来获取所需的数据,实现数据的共享和共同使用。这样可以提高数据的利用率和工作效率,避免数据的重复存储和维护。

    2. 冗余度小:数据库中的数据冗余度尽可能小,即避免数据的重复存储和维护。通过数据的集中存储和统一管理,可以减少数据的冗余度,节省存储空间,并且减少了数据的维护和更新的复杂性。

    3. 数据的独立性:数据库中的数据与数据的逻辑结构、数据的物理存储和数据的应用程序之间是相互独立的。这种独立性使得数据库的结构和数据的存储方式可以根据需求进行改变,而不会影响到数据的应用程序。这样可以提高数据库的灵活性和可扩展性。

    4. 数据的持久性:数据库中的数据是永久存储的,即使在计算机系统断电或发生故障时,数据也能够保持不变。通过使用数据库管理系统,可以实现数据的持久性,保证数据的安全性和可靠性。同时,数据库还提供了数据的备份和恢复机制,以防止数据的丢失和损坏。

    这四个特征是数据库设计和管理的基本原则,能够提高数据的共享性、减少冗余度、实现数据的独立性和保证数据的持久性,从而提高数据的管理效率和数据的可靠性。

    3个月前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库的四个特征是指持久性、共享性、独立性和可并发性。

    1. 持久性:指数据库的数据是持久保存在存储介质中的,不会因为计算机系统的断电或重启而丢失。数据库管理系统(DBMS)会自动将数据写入磁盘或其他永久存储设备中,以确保数据的持久性。

    2. 共享性:指多个用户可以同时访问数据库,并且可以在同一时间对数据库进行读取和修改操作。数据库管理系统会根据用户的权限和访问控制规则来控制用户对数据库的访问和操作。

    3. 独立性:指数据库的逻辑结构与物理结构相互独立。逻辑独立性是指数据库的逻辑结构(如表、视图、索引等)可以独立于物理存储结构(如磁盘块、文件等)进行修改和变更,而不会影响到用户对数据的操作。物理独立性是指数据库的物理存储结构可以独立于数据库的逻辑结构进行修改和变更,而不会影响到用户对数据的操作。

    4. 可并发性:指多个用户可以同时访问数据库,并且可以在同一时间对数据库进行读取和修改操作,而不会相互干扰。数据库管理系统会使用锁机制和事务处理来实现并发控制,保证数据库的一致性和完整性。

    这四个特征是数据库系统设计和实现的基本原则,能够提供高效、可靠和安全的数据管理和操作功能。

    3个月前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部